Deliver

Verb

Definiciones

1.VerbTo set free from restraint or danger.
"The hostage was delivered from her captors and thus preserved from any danger."
2.VerbSenses having to do with birth. To assist in the birth of.
"the doctor delivered the baby; the duchess was delivered of a son; the doctor is expected to deliver her of a daughter tomorrow; she delivered a baby boy yesterday"
3.VerbTo assist in the birth of.
"the doctor delivered the baby"
4.VerbTo assist (a female) in bearing, that is, in bringing forth (a child).
"the duchess was delivered of a son; the doctor is expected to deliver her of a daughter tomorrow"
5.VerbTo give birth to.
"she delivered a baby boy yesterday"
6.VerbTo free from or disburden of anything.
7.VerbTo bring or transport something to its destination.
"deliver a package; deliver the mail"
8.VerbTo hand over or surrender (someone or something) to another.
"deliver the thief to the police"
9.VerbTo produce what is expected or required.
"deliver on a promise"
10.VerbTo express in words or vocalizations, declare, utter, or vocalize.
"deliver a speech"
11.VerbTo give forth in action or exercise; to discharge.
"to deliver a blow"
12.VerbTo discover; to show.
13.VerbTo administer a drug.
14.AdjectiveCapable, agile, or active.
